i can see why people would be pissed if they got it full price because there isnt that much content in the game only like 12 levels and sp is just mp with bots but it has a lot of cool things like inbetween multiplayer levels theres ittle videos to explain the story that goes through the levels.
alot of other cool things, like you do challenges to unlock weapons and attachments, xp gets you points to buy skills and unlocks clothing, lots of customization on weapons and clothes (4 attachments per gun, euston + front grip + drum mag + muzzle brake +red dot is incredible)
and gameplay wise its spot on, very fluid has a very oldschool unreal/ quake vibe slightly slower with bits of modern fps mixed in
freerunning works great ut the absolute shine is on the sliding move, its the most useful thing in a shooter ever for getting away from a fight and words cannot explain how satisfying it is to slide tackle someone while emptying an smg into them!
death systems pretty good, spawns working in waves that are usally 30 seconds, when you die you go into last stand but it takes quite a few bullets to kill you in this so people dont bother wasting their ammo ammo then you can choose to wait for a medic to come chuck you a syringe to revive yourself, you can choose either on the fly so your not tied down either if it looks like a medic isnt coming
buff system works reallly nice and quickly, all takes a second or two then the effects are instant
downsides:
if people dont work together on your team and the other team does the game turns into a meat grinder and gets pretty annoying
runs like shit for people that have ATI/ AMD cards cause the game runs in openGL
selecting objectives is awkward with the mouse because it works the same way you select weapons on bioshock 2 on xbox
thats about it really well worth picking up, will reignite your hope for gaming, feels very fresh fun and addictive, what it lacks in content it makes up for in quality, ALL the levels / weapons are alll very varied and well balanced
